How Global Uncertainty Affects Employees Psychologically

Global events create psychological instability, leading to decreased motivation and productivity in organizations. As uncertainty rises, employees worry about their job security due to geopolitical factors, causing internal tension within companies.

Melhina Magaña, co-founder of Daucon, explains in her webinar “High Performance in Times of Uncertainty” that four primary psychological effects emerge during high uncertainty:

  • Indefensión Aprendida: Occurs when prolonged exposure to uncertainty causes individuals to lose hope and alter their behavior.
  • Increased Stress: Constant stress leads to impulsive, unreasoned decisions and losing sight of task purposes.
  • Intolerance to Uncertainty: Prolonged exposure to uncertainty causes anxiety and negative speculation.

Tolerating uncertainty is a mental muscle that needs training; some have higher tolerance than others.

Motivating Teams Amid Uncertainty

High exposure to uncertainty causes employees to lose motivation. To counteract this, Magaña advises leaders to adopt empathetic leadership.

  • Increase team autonomy, allowing employees to explore, suggest solutions, and resolve issues independently.
  • Eliminate low-value tasks or projects to prevent unnecessary pressure and stress.

“Leaders must step back and act as mentors, raising the level of autonomy to connect it with purpose-driven motivation.”

Protecting Leaders from Uncertainty’s Impact

In volatile futures, people seek trustworthy figures; for organizations, this role falls on leaders. However, constant exposure to uncertainty and tension can also affect leaders psychologically.

  • Prioritize mental health by analyzing and adjusting schedules, prioritizing free time, and investing in stress-reducing recreational activities.
  • Develop strategic planning for both favorable and unfavorable scenarios to maintain emotional stability and strengthen decision-making capabilities.

Engage in activities you enjoy to support your mental health, energy, and overall well-being.
